19 members of my family stayed in this house and the one word to describe this vacation was "perfect". The house is definitely big enough for everyone to have their space but also provides enough space for everyone to gather for meals, etc. (pool table was also a big hit). The short walk to the beach was perfect with public access right across the street. The IGA within walking distance has everything you could possibly need. We didn't eat out much but it was only a short drive to Barefoot Landing where we went a few times for dinner/shopping (also a short drive to fast food places, Walmart, etc.). The dryer stopped working while we were there and when we called, a repairman was there within hours. The furniture and beds are very comfortable. There is plenty of parking, we had 8 cars there and didn't have a shortage of parking at all. I would highly recommend this house and am going to be booking it again for another family reunion in the near future.

Our family reunion was a total success at this home. We had 22 staying at the home and everyone seemed to have their own space. The kids loved the pool (larger than we expected) and the beach was just steps away. The ocean views were ok from the side decks but the view of the marsh from the front of the home was spectacular, especially at sunset. WE saw dolphins in the marsh at high tide which was a real treat for the kids.

The kitchen had everything we needed for cooking for 22. The double refrigerators were a life saver. The one charcoal grill wasn't big enough but we also used the extra park grill and between the two of them we had plenty of room to cook for us all.

The outside of the house could use pressure washing and a little paint but the inside looked pretty good considering it was the end of the summer. It was clean and the furniture was comfortable with plenty of seating. The bedrooms were very nice especially the two master suites.

The kids fished and crabbed in the marsh at the park just 2 blocks away. We also rented a pontoon boat in Little River which everyone enjoyed.

The guys enjoyed the pool table in the evenings and there was a tv in every room so the kids could watch what they wanted. We had a little trouble with the WiFi but we got it worked out (thank god for 12 year olds) and we could plug in direct to the internet in the living room.

We had a problem with sand in the hot tub (we put it there) and we called the mgmt company. the pool guy came out the next day and took care of it. After that we made the kids shower before jumping in the hot tub and we had no more problem.

I would highly recommend this home for a family or group of friends. Would probably be great for a bunch of golfers too. It looks just like the pictures, is real close to the beach and seems to be well maintained. We will probably be back next summer.
